left设置的是百分比,如何用jq获取该百分比,而不是具体的像素

left设置的是百分比,如何用jq获取该百分比,而不是具体的像素,第1张

’使用jq获取left组件的百分此如下例如:$("#righttd:first").offset().top

$(document).ready(function() {

$("#nameit").blur(function() {

$("#msgdiv").css({

top : $("#righttd:first").offset().top,

left : $("#righttd:first").offset().left - 40,

visibility:"visible"

})

})

$("#nameit").focus(function() {

$("#msgdiv").css({

visibility:"hidden"

})

})

})

JQ动画:5秒内top匀速增加50px,left匀速增加20px

$(craneUp).animate({top:'+=50px', left:'+=20px'}, 5000)

也可以去了解下css3的动画

修改div的位置,其实就是修改div的left和top值。

思路:

先选出div这个对象。

修改div的left和top值。

下面是代码:

<script src="jquery-1.7.2.js"></script>

    <body>

     <div style="width:100px height:100px background:#ccc position:absolute left:100px top:100px" id="div"></div>

    </body>

    <script>

 $('#div').css({'left':'300px','top':'300px'})

    </script>


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/tougao/7749677.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-09
下一篇 2023-04-09

发表评论

登录后才能评论

评论列表(0条)

保存